Lotus won't run new car at Jerez
Getty Images Enlarge Lotus has announced that it won't run it's 2014 car - the E22 - at the first pre-season test at Jerez. The first test takes place in three weeks' time, with engine manufacturers keen to run in January in order to get an early indication of how the new power units are performing. However, technical director Nick Chester says Lotus will be taking more time to develop its new car and only plans on running it at the two Bahrain tests in February. "We're going to keep our car under wraps a little longer than some other teams," Chester said. "We've decided that attending the Jerez test isn't ideal for our build and development programme.
